PropertiesRe: Need Estimate For A Fence In Ibadan by abdulwastecx(m): 11:39pm On Apr 29, 2015
perimeter of the fence = 2x30(100) + 2x36(120) = 132m height of fence = 4x225 = 900mm = 0.9m area = 0.9x132 = 118.5m2 = 120m2 number required = 120 x 10 = 1200blocks
blocks = 1500blocks cement = 10bags sand = 1/2 trip
workmanship for the block = N90,000 ( for 9" blocks) = N75,000 ( for 6" blocks)

PropertiesRe: Proper Analysis Of Design And Cost Of A Foundation Design For Bungalows by abdulwastecx(op): 8:59pm On Apr 22, 2015
mix ratio for foundation footing for bungalow should either be 1:3:6 or 1:2:4 for normal soil.
i prefer 1:2:4 ( 1 bag of cement : 4 head pan of sand or 1 wheel barrow of sand : 8 head pan of gravel or 2 wheel barrow of gravel). reason been that the foundation of bungalow is very important because it help to distributes the wall load to foundation adequately.
A typical foundations supporting a three bedroom flat or its equivalent should have the following features

1. minimum thickness of 100mm ( 4'') and should not more than 225mm (9'') thick on a strong soil for economy reason.
2. the sharp sand should not be too smooth and free from clay and other dirt which may reduce the strength of concrete
3. the gravel should be preferably 3/4 ( 20mm) thick and must be free from dust.
4. the water for mixing should be drinkable and free from salt and other chemical contamination
5. the water-cement ratio must not be greater than 0.6.


mode of calculating the volume of concrete for foundation footings ( strip foundation).
1. get the sum of the total gird of the substructure, let say 'P' = 50 ( example)
2. get the width of the foundation, say 450mm (18'') for 150mm ( 6"wink wall and 675mm ( 27" ) for 225mm (9"wink wall
3. Assume a thickness of say 150mm for 6" wall and or 225mm for 9" wall.
4. convert all your dimension to 'm'
5. hence volume, v =50x 0.45 x 0.15 = 3.375m3
6. increase the volume by 25% to cater for shrinkage and wastage. =1.25 x 3.375= 4.05m3

using mix ratio 1:2:4
part of cement = 1/7 x4.05 =0.58m3
since the density of ordinary Portland cement s 1506kg/m3
and i bag = 50kg
hence, no of bags = 0.58 x 1506/50 =17.4bags ( 18 bags aprox.)

part of sand = 2/7 x 4.05 =1.16m3
since the density of sharp sand is 1600kg/m3 and a tonne of sharp sand is 1000kg
hence, 1.16 x 1600/1000 = 1.856tonnes ( 2 tonnes aprox.)

part of gravel = 2 x 1.16 = 2.32m3
since the density of gravel is 2400kg/m3 and a tonne of gravel weight 1000kg
hence, 2.32 x 2.4 =5.57tonnes ( 6 tonnes )

part of water using water cement ratio of 0.6
weight of water = 0.6 weight of cement = 0.6 x 18 x 50 =540kg
volume of water required, from density = mass/volume
making volume subject, volume = mass/density
where density of water = 1000kg/m3
hence, volume of water required = 540/1000= 0.54m3
since,1m3 = 1000liters
volume of water required = 540 liters

PropertiesRe: The Construction Of 14 Class Room At Emuhoa Community Rivers State by abdulwastecx(op): 6:56pm On Apr 21, 2015
jfkenny:
Weld one Sir.
Pls what is the distance between the rods as well between stirrup
links spacing ( distance between stirrup ) for columns ( Pillars) = 300mm
rods are spaced a distance of 'x' from one another based on section of columns, number of bars in a column and thickness of cover.
for this column
cover =25mm
section = 225 x 225mm

distance between rod in a column = 225 - 50 = 175mm
x = 175mm
